Ducks and rabbits have 45 heads and 146 feet in the same cage, and there are many ducks and rabbits

  1. Anonymous users2024-02-05

    This question gives a total of 45 ducks and rabbits. If we assume that all 45 of these are rabbits, there should be 180 legs. And this question only tells us that there are 146 feet, and I calculated that 180 feet are 34 feet more than the actual one.

    That's because 1 duck has 2 legs, and we count it as 4 legs. If 1 duck is exchanged for 1 rabbit, we have to lose 2 legs, then, how many 2 legs are contained in 34 feet, that is, how many ducks we take as rabbits, obviously, 34 2 17 (only). So there are 17 ducks and 28 rabbits.

  2. Anonymous users2024-02-04

    Suppose x ducks, then rabbits are 45-x. So, the number of their legs is: 2x+(45-x)*4=146, and the solution is x=17, that is, if there are 17 ducks, then there are 45-17=28 rabbits. Complete.
